Iran’s Sports and Youth Minister Ahmad Donyamali has announced that the country will not participate in the 2026 FIFA World Cup, citing escalating geopolitical tensions and security concerns. Speaking to Iranian state television on Wednesday, Donyamali said Iran could not take part in a tournament partially hosted by the United States, following recent military tensions involving the U.S. and its allies. He stated that under the current circumstances, it would be impossible for the national team to travel and compete in the tournament. English Premier League giants Arsenal FC have paid tribute to the late Kenyan statesman and Gor Mahia Patron Raila Odinga by sending a commemorative piece of memorabilia recognising his well-known support for the North London club. The tribute was received in Nairobi on Wednesday, March 11, 2026, by Philip Etale, who collected the parcel on behalf of the former Prime Minister and leader of the Orange Democratic Movement (ODM). The Football Kenya Federation (FKF) has obtained orders from the High Court at Milimani Law Courts suspending the implementation of a ruling by the Sports Disputes Tribunal (SDT) concerning the abandoned match between Gor Mahia FC and Nairobi United FC. The High Court granted FKF leave and stay orders, effectively halting the enforcement of the tribunal’s decision until the case is fully heard and determined. Background of the Dispute The SDT had earlier quashed a decision by FKF to award both teams one point each following the abandonment of their league match. Nominated MP Irene Nyakerario Mayaka has introduced a new legislative proposal aimed at safeguarding the integrity of sports competitions in the country. The Sports (Amendment) Bill, National Assembly Bill No. 5 of 2026, was formally tabled in the National Assembly of Kenya and has already undergone its First Reading. The Bill seeks to amend the Sports Act to prohibit and criminalize match fixing and manipulation of sports competitions, a move widely seen as a major step toward protecting fair play in Kenyan sports.
